R247 JFR is a 1998 Rover 420 in Red with a 1,994cc diesel engine. This vehicle has been through 13 MOT tests with a personal pass rate of 53.8%.
Across all 1998 Rover 420 models, the average MOT pass rate is 62.6% with a typical mileage of 99,006 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Rover 420 fails its MOT is constant velocity joint gaiter split, accounting for 35,342 recorded failures. If you're considering buying R247 JFR, it's worth having these areas checked by a mechanic before committing.
The Rover 420 typically stays on UK roads for around 33 years. At 28 years old, this Rover 420 is approaching the upper end of the typical lifespan for this model.
